Skip to content

[CALCITE-7539] Upgrade Arrow adapter dependencies to 16.0.0#4955

Closed
caicancai wants to merge 1 commit into
apache:mainfrom
caicancai:calcite-7539-upgrade-arrow-17
Closed

[CALCITE-7539] Upgrade Arrow adapter dependencies to 16.0.0#4955
caicancai wants to merge 1 commit into
apache:mainfrom
caicancai:calcite-7539-upgrade-arrow-17

Conversation

@caicancai
Copy link
Copy Markdown
Member

@caicancai caicancai commented May 21, 2026

Upgrade Arrow adapter dependencies to 16.0.0.\n\nNotes from compatibility checks:\n- Arrow 18.0.0 was evaluated but is blocked because arrow-vector is Java 11 bytecode while Calcite CI still includes JDK 8.\n- Arrow 17.0.0 and 16.1.0 were evaluated but are blocked on JDK 8 runtime by Java 9+ ByteBuffer.flip() binary incompatibility.\n- Arrow/Gandiva 16.0.0 is the current safe upgrade target for the existing CI matrix.\n\nValidation:\n- JAVA_HOME=/opt/homebrew/opt/openjdk@21 ./gradlew :arrow:clean :arrow:test

@caicancai caicancai closed this May 21, 2026
@caicancai caicancai deleted the calcite-7539-upgrade-arrow-17 branch May 21, 2026 08:07
@caicancai caicancai changed the title [CALCITE-7539] Upgrade Arrow adapter dependencies to 17.0.0 [CALCITE-7539] Upgrade Arrow adapter dependencies to 16.0.0 May 21,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ant